Abstract

The article deals with the issues of electoral behavior of an individual in the party space. The author gives an analytical justification for measuring the volume of electoral activity of voters depending on the motivation for political participation, and gives the formulas for calculating the coefficients of political activity to study the possible reaction of voters to certain changes in the electoral process. The observed trend towards a change in the number of party members depends on the election period. In addition, the article presents the factors of elasticity of the party space: the time of the election campaigns, the presence of party substitutes and other factors. The author argues that the assessment of flexibility can be explained by voting behavior in elections.
